Measurement of μ charged-current single π0 production on hydrocarbon in the few-GeV region using MINERvA

Abstract

The semi-exclusive channel μ+CH→μ-π0+nucleon(s) is analyzed using MINERvA exposed to the low-energy NuMI μ beam with spectral peak at E 3 GeV. Differential cross sections for muon momentum and production angle, π0 kinetic energy and production angle, and for squared four-momentum transfer are reported, and the cross section σ(E) is obtained over the range 1.5 GeV ≤ E < 20 GeV. Results are compared to GENIE and NuWro predictions and to published MINERvA cross sections for μ-CC(π+) and μ-CC(π0). Disagreements between data and simulation are observed at very low and relatively high values for muon angle and for Q2 that may reflect shortfalls in modeling of interactions on carbon. For π0 kinematic distributions however, the data are consistent with the simulation and provide support for generator treatments of pion intranuclear scattering. Using signal-event subsamples that have reconstructed protons as well as π0 mesons, the pπ0 invariant mass distribution is obtained, and the decay polar and azimuthal angle distributions in the rest frame of the pπ0 system are measured in the region of (1232)+ production, W < 1.4 GeV.
